Title: Re: Andrew miller
Post by: MonicaL on Thursday 10 January 08 23:22 GMT (UK)
For William Miller and Ann Bain, as background which I am guessing you already have some (but helps to get it into my head  ;)):

WILLIAM MILLER  Marriages: ANN BAIN    Marriage:  23 NOV 1805  Bower, Caithness, Scotland

Their children's births, mostly backed up by the OPRs:

1. Donald Miller  Birth: 30 SEP 1806 Lyth, Bower, Caithness, Scotland
2. John Miller  Birth: 02 MAY 1808 Lyth, Bower, Caithness, Scotland
3. George Miller Birth: 10 FEB 1809 Lyth, Bower, Caithness, Scotland
4. Andrew Miller Christening: 28 JUL 1809 Wick, Caithness, Scotland
5. Margaret Miller Birth: 17 APR 1811 Lyth, Bower, Caithness, Scotland
6. William Miller Birth: 22 SEP 1812 Lyth, Bower, Caithness, Scotland
7. James Miller: Birth 28 SEP 1814 Bower, Caithness, Scotland


This is the closest I can see on the 1841/51 Censuses for parents William (a farmer according to Andrew's DC) and Ann:

1841
William Miller    63, farmer
Ann Miller    60
Barbara McKenzie 15, FS

Address:  Howe, wick

1851
William Miller    72, farmer, b. Bower
Ann Miller 72, b. Dunnet

Address:  Ruthers Of Howe, Wick

No sign of a death for William post 1855 so hard to confirm parents' names.  Ann Bain's death refs:

1863   MILLER   ANNE   LAING (mother's maiden name)   BAIN   86   WICK LANDWARD   /CAITHNESS   043/02 0030

Submitted details on IGI for Anne's parents:

Donald Bain  Birth: About 1742 Bowermadden, Bower, Caithness, Scotland
Marriages: Spouse: Margaret Laing 18 JAN 1767 Bower, Caithness, Scotland

With William and Anne's children's naming order, you would think William's father's name would be John, sadly no daughters' names other than Margaret after Anne's mother. There are two possibilities showing on the OPRs:

1   13/03/1780   MILLER   WILLIAM   JOHN MILLER/ANE CORMACK FR 112   U   Bower   /CAITHNESS   034/ 0010 0189   
2   06/09/1782   MILLER   WILLIAM   JOHN MILLER/HELLEN BAIN FR 124   U   Bower   /CAITHNESS   034/ 0010 0201
